Ayberk Balkan

Skewb · top 4.6% of 73,281 all-time · competing since May 2022 · 2022BALK01

Ayberk Balkan has been competing for 4 years. His best event is the Skewb: a personal-best single of 2.92, set at İstanbul April 2026, puts him in the top 4.6% of the 73,281 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 18th in Turkey. Until February 2014, no official Skewb solve in the world had been that fast. Across 9 competitions since May 2022, he has put 307 official solves on the record across six events. Solve to solve, his 3×3 times vary about 11% around a typical one, steadier than 88% of the 35,811 competitors with ten or more counted rounds. His 2×2 best has come down from 9.36 in May 2022 to 2.02, a 78% improvement. Ayberk has entered nine competitions, more competitions than 91% of everyone who has ever competed.
